ABSTRACT:
A picture element data density conversion apparatus, enabling arbitrary amounts of data density reduction to be independently selected for the horizontal (i.e. main) and vertical (i.e. secondary) scanning directions of a picture field, executes processing along a continuous path in which horizontally successive input values along each line of the field are first periodically selected and horizontal weighted averaging between specific pairs of these selected values is executed, then periodic selection of successive lines of the horizontal weighted average values thus obtained is executed, and vertical weighting averaging between vertically corresponding pairs of values in the selected line pairs is performed, to obtain density-reduced output data.
